在MySQL中设置数据库连接超时时间,可以通过几种不同的方式实现,具体取决于你的需求和使用场景。以下是几种常见的方法: 通过MySQL配置文件设置: 概念:通过修改MySQL的配置文件(如my.cnf或my.ini),可以永久性地更改连接超时时间。 步骤: 找到并编辑MySQL的配置文件。这个文件通常位于MySQL的安装目录下。 在[mysqld]...
上述设置将等待超时时间设为8小时。您可以根据实际情况调整这些值。 通过SQL语句临时设置:如果您没有修改配置文件的权限,可以在每次连接时通过SQL语句临时设置超时时间: SETSESSION wait_timeout =28800;SETSESSION interactive_timeout =28800; 检查其他潜在因素: 防火墙和网络延迟:确保服务器与数据库之间的网络连接稳定...
# 替换为你的数据库用户名'password':'your_password',# 替换为你的数据库密码'host':'127.0.0.1',# 数据库服务器地址'database':'your_database',# 替换为你的数据库名称'connection_timeout':10# 设置连接超时时间为10秒}try:# 连接到数据库connection=mysql.connector.connect(**config)ifconnection...
loginTimeout=30";// 30秒超时Stringuser="root";Stringpassword="password";try{DriverManager.setLoginTimeout(30);// 设置连接超时时间为30秒Connectionconnection=DriverManager.getConnection(url,user,password);System.out.println("数据库连接成功!");// 在这里处理数据库操作}catch(SQLExceptione){System.err.pri...
statement_timeout是一个PostgreSQL服务器参数,用于设置单个SQL语句的执行超时时间。当一个查询执行的时间超过了设定的超时时间,PostgreSQL将终止该查询并返回一个错误信息。这个参数可以帮助我们防止长时间运行的查询对数据库性能造成影响,同时也有助于保护数据库免受恶意攻击。如何设置statement_timeout?要设置statement_...
MySQL数据库连接超时时间可以通过配置文件或者编程方式进行设置。具体的设置方法取决于使用的编程语言和数据库连接库。 在MySQL中,可以通过以下方式设置连接超时时间: 配置文件方式:在MySQL的配置文件(my.cnf或者my.ini)中,可以使用wait_timeout参数来设置连接超时时间,该参数的单位是秒。可以在文件中添加以下配置行: 配...
2. 连接池超时设置 maxWait:表示从数据库连接池取链接,连接池没有可用连接时的等待时间,默认值0,表示无限等待,单位毫秒,建议60000 3. MyBatis查询超时 defaultStatementTimeout:表示在MyBatis配置文件中默认查询超时间,单位秒,不设置则无线等待 如果一些sql需要执行超过defaultStatementTimeout可以通过Mapper文件单独的sql...
mysql设置数据库连接超时 mysql 连接超时设置 mysql数据库超时时间设置 mysql 连接超时时间 mysql设置超时时间 mysql超时时间设置 linux 连接 超时时间设置 查看mysql数据库连接超时时间 mysql设置执行超时时间设置 mysql数据库连接超时设置没反应 mysql设置超时时间 linux ...
通过调用SQLSetConnectAttr函数,可以设置连接属性,包括连接超时时间。 在Oracle数据库端设置:在Oracle数据库端也可以设置连接超时时间。通过修改sqlnet.ora文件中的SQLNET.INBOUND_CONNECT_TIMEOUT参数来设置连接超时时间。 无论采用哪种方法,都应该根据具体情况和需求来选择设置连接超时时间的方式。
Spring Boot设置数据库超时时间 1. 简介 在使用Spring Boot开发应用程序时,经常需要与数据库进行交互。为了提高性能和应用程序的稳定性,我们通常需要设置数据库的超时时间,以确保数据库连接不会因为长时间不活动而被关闭。 本文将介绍如何在Spring Boot中设置数据库超时时间。首先,我们将给出整个设置流程的简单步骤,然后...